处理结果

对报告响应的处理至关重要,当您希望您的解决方案具有灵活性且能够独立于您在报告中选择的实际维度和指标时尤为如此。

值得庆幸的是,报告响应相当完整且包含大量实用信息。

标头

您可以使用标头中返回的信息来选择如何设定特定指标的格式。它包含了以下信息:指标类型,是否是货币、比率或结算等,使用的币种(如果是货币价值)。

示例:

"headers": [
  { "name": "MONTH", "type": "DIMENSION" },
  { "name": "CLICKS", "type": "METRIC_TALLY" },
  { "name": "EARNINGS", "type": "METRIC_CURRENCY", "currency": "USD" },
  { "name": "AD_REQUESTS_COVERAGE", "type": "METRIC_RATIO" }
]

您会在此处看到实际的报告结果。每个响应行代表报告中的一行,根据您选择的维度,每行具有不同的含义。

示例:

"rows": [
  [ "2014-01", "278", "63.12", "0.9998" ],
  [ "2014-02", "39", "8.46", "0.9998" ]
]

总数和平均值

在生成报告时,您还得到返回的totalsaverages实用程序数组,这将包含每个相应指标的值。

示例:

"totals": [ "", "317", "71.58", "0.9998" ]
"averages": [ "", "158", "35.79", null ]

开始日期和结束日期

如果您使用的是相对日期,则有时了解所计算的开始日期和结束日期会很有用。

示例:

"startDate": "2014-01-01"
"endDate": "2014-02-28"

后续步骤

发送以下问题的反馈:

此网页
AdSense Management API
AdSense Management API